Background: The Italian Renal Cell Cancer Early Access Program was an expanded access program that allowed access to nivolumab, for patients (pts) with mRCC prior to regulatory approval. Methods: Pts with mRCC previously treated with agents targeting the vascular endothelial growth factor pathway were eligible to receive nivolumab 3 mg/kg once every 2 weeks. Pts included in the analysis had received ≥ 1 dose of nivolumab and were monitored for adverse events (AEs) using CTCAE v.4.0. Association between sex, age, BMI, metastatic sites, number and kind of previous therapies, ECOG PS and related toxicity were evaluated with a logistic regression model that identified only age ≥ 65 years (Odds Ratio= 1.54 (1.00-2.38; P = 0.05). Results: A total of 389 pts were enrolled between July 2015 and April 2016, 79% after 2 or more lines of therapy. The most common any-grade treatment-related AEs were fatigue (13%) and rash (9%). Twenty-two (5.7%) pts discontinued treatment due to AEs. There were no treatment-related deaths. Treatment-related AEs (grade 1-4) were reported in 32% of pts. Median time to appearance of AEs was 1.4 months (range 0-11.4). Grade 3–4 AEs occurred in 27 (7%) pts. Of the 22 serious AEs who induced treatment discontinuation, 11 (50%) were considered irAEs including: grade 4 hyperglicemia (n = 1), grade 3 diarrhea (n = 1), grade 3 pulmonitis (n = 1), grade 3 bronchiolitis obliterans organising pneumonia (BOOP) (n = 1), grade 3 asthenia (n = 1), grade 3 hypertension (n = 1), grade 3 skin toxicity (n = 1), grade 3 tremor (n = 1), grade 2 eyelid ptosis (n = 1), grade 2 liver toxicity (n = 1), grade 2 hypothyroidism (n = 1). AEs were generally manageable with treatment as per protocol-specific guidelines. At a median follow-up of 12 months, the median progression-free survival was 4.5 months (95% CI 3.7 - 6.2), the 12-months overall survival rate was 63%. Pts with toxicity (124 pts) had a significant (P = 0.01) longer survival (1 year OS 69%) in comparison to pts who did not experience AEs (1 year OS 59%). Conclusions: The appearance of AEs strongly correlates with survival benefit in a real-life population of mRCC pts treated with Nivolumab. Background: The risk of developing renal cell carcinoma (RCC) increases with age, and given the constant gain in life expectancy of the general population, RCC is frequently observed in the elderly. More than 80% of cancer pts aged ≥ 70 years have at least one comorbidity requiring treatment, leaving them exposed to drug interactions. Due to high frequency of comorbidities, these pts are often under-represented in clinical trials. The purpose of this analysis is to evaluate the feasibility of treatment with nivolumab in the elderly (≥ 70 years) and very elderly (≥ 75 years) in the EAP in Italy, given a more realistic picture of real world setting. Methods: Nivolumab was available upon physician request for pts aged ≥18 years who had relapsed after at least one prior systemic treatment in the advanced or metastatic setting. Nivolumab 3 mg/kg was administered intravenously every 2 weeks to a maximum of 24 months. Pts included in the analysis had received ≥ 1 dose of nivolumab and were monitored for adverse events (AEs) using Common Terminology Criteria for Adverse Events. Results: Of 389 Italian pts with mRCC enrolled in the EAP in Italy 125 pts (32%) had ≥70 years and 70 (18%) had ≥75 years. With a median follow-up of 9.8 months (0.1-16.2) in the elderly population (≥70 years), the disease control rate (DCR) was 58% including 1 patient in complete response (CR), 32 pts in partial response (PR) and 40 patients in stable disease (SD). Regarding the very elderly population (≥75 years), with a median follow-up of 9.8 months (0.1 -14.9), the DCR was 60% including 1 patient with CR, 19 pts with PR and 22 with SD. As of May 2017, 6 and 12 months overall survival (OS) rate were 87.2% and 77.8% respectively in the elderly population. Regarding the very elderly, the 6 and 12 months OS rate was 83.6% and 77.7%, respectively. The safety profile was consistent to what already observed in the general population. Conclusions: These results suggest that elderly population can benefit from nivolumab treatment with safety results consistent to what previously reported, supporting the use of nivolumab in this subpopulation. BACKGROUNDPrevious studies investigating the prognostic role of mucinous histology of colorectal cancer produced conflicting results. This retrospective analysis was carried out in order to explore whether mucinous adenocarcinoma (MC) is associated with a comparatively worse prognosis than that of nonmucinous adenocarcinoma (NMC) for patients undergoing curative resection for stage II and III colon cancer.PATIENTS AND METHODSThis study involved 1025 unselected patients who underwent curative surgery for sporadic colon cancer and follow-up procedures at six different oncology departments.RESULTSMCs accounted for 17.4% (n=178) of tumours. Patients with MC had 5- and 8-year overall survival rates of 78.6% and 68.8%, respectively, compared with 72.3% and 63.8%, respectively, for patients with nonmucinous tumours. Multivariate analysis using the Cox proportional hazards model showed that the clinically significant prognostic factors were stage of disease and adjuvant chemotherapy. No statistically significant interaction between mucinous histology and adjuvant chemotherapy was found.CONCLUSIONSFor patients with stage II and III colon cancer who underwent curative surgery, mucinous histology has no significant correlation with prognosis compared with NMC. This retrospective analysis suggests a comparable benefit from adjuvant chemotherapy for MC compared with NMC.
e16611 Background: Many cancer patients (pts) receive chemotherapy at the end of life (EOL) with negative effects on quality of life and high economic burden. Palliative care services and hospice facilities became widely available in Italy during the last decade. We analyzed if this had an impact on chemotherapy use at EOL comparing current data with those obtained in a study carried out in year 2002, where we observed 33% of pts treated with chemotherapy in the last month of life (Giorgi et al. Proc ASCO 22: #6081, 2004). Methods: We performed a retrospective chart review of pts died in year 2010 and treated in three oncology divisions in which palliative care and hospice services have been available since 2004. Results were compared with those obtained in year 2002 when there was no palliative care program in the same oncology units. Results: Clinical records of 335 pts dead during 2010 were reviewed (F 156, M 179). The most frequent tumors were: breast 53 pts, NSCLC 53, colorectal 48, gastric 30, pancreas 16, prostate 13. Median age was 71 years (range 22-96). Seventy-one pts (21 %) received chemotherapy and 16 pts (5 %) targeted therapies in the last month of life (aggregate 26 %). In the last week of life 10 pts received chemotherapy and 8 pts targeted therapies (5 %). One hundred ninety-two pts (57%) entered a palliative care/hospice program managed by oncologists of the same unit: 126 pts home palliative care and 66 pts hospice care. Despite the expansion of standard second and third line chemotherapy and targeted therapy in the oncologist's therapeutic arsenal, we observed a 7 % reduction (21% relative reduction) of cancer-directed interventions in the last month of life. Conclusions: We observed a 21% relative reduction in anticancer treatment provided at the EOL between 2002 and 2010. We believe that most of this reduction can be ascribed to the implementation of palliative care services where oncologists ensure continuity of care. Maintaining a stable oncologist-patient relationship may foster better EOL decisions and utilization of health care resources.
BACKGROUND:A large proportion of colorectal cancer patients does not benefit from the use of anti-epidermal growth factor receptor (EGFR) treatment although in the absence of a mutation of the K-RAS gene. Preliminary observations suggested that HER-3, insulin-like growth factor-1 (IGF-1), nuclear factor-kB (NF-kB) and EGFR gene copy number (GCN) might identify patients not likely to benefit from anti-EGFR therapy. We tested the interaction between HER-3, IGF-1, NF-kB, EGFR GCN and K-RAS mutational analysis to verify the relative ability of these variables to identify a subgroup of patients more likely to benefit from EGFR-targeted treatment among those harbouring a K-RAS wild-type status. PATIENTS AND METHODS:We retrospectively collected tumours from 168 patients with metastatic colorectal cancer treated with irinotecan-cetuximab. K-RAS was assessed with direct sequencing, EGFR amplification was assessed by chromogenic in situ hybridisation (CISH) and HER-3, IGF-1 and NF-kB were assessed by immunohistochemistry. RESULTS:In patients with K-RAS wild-type tumours, the following molecular factors resulted independently associated with response rate: HER-3 [odds ratio (OR)=4.6, 95% confidence interval (CI) 1.8-13.6, P=0.02], IGF-1 (OR=4.2, 95% CI 2-10.2, P=0.003) and EGFR GCN (OR=4.1, 95% CI 1.9-26.2, P=0.04). These factors also independently correlated with overall survival as follows: HER-3 [hazard ratio (HR)=0.4, 95% CI 0.28-0.85, P=0.008], IGF-1 (HR=0.47, 95% CI 0.24-0.76, P<0.0001) and EGFR GCN (HR=0.59, 95% CI 0.22-0.89, P=0.04). DISCUSSION:We believe that our data may help further composing the molecular mosaic of EGFR-resistant tumours. The role of HER-3, IGF-1 and CISH EGFR GCN should be prospectively validated in clinical trials investigating anti-EGFR treatment strategies in colorectal cancer patients.
404 Background: Preclinical data suggested that in presence of HER3 altered activation colorectal cancer cells may escape anti-EGFR mediated cell death. HER3 overexpression may then represent a key factor for resistance to anti-EGFR antibodies in colorectal cancer. The aim of our analysis was to investigate a possible correlation between HER3 expression and clinical outcome in KRAS wild-type advanced colorectal cancer receiving cetuximab and irinotecan.METHODSWe retrospectively analyzed immunoreactivity for HER3 in KRAS wild-type advanced colorectal cancer patients receiving irinotecan-cetuximab.RESULTSEighty-four advanced KRAS wild- type colorectal cancer patients were available for HER3 analysis. Forty patients (48%) showed HER3 negative colorectal tumor, whereas the remaining 44 cases (52%) were deemed HER3 positive. In HER3 negative and HER3 positive tumors we observed a partial response in 17 (42%) and 8 (18%) patients respectively (p = 0.04). Progressive disease was obtained in 11 (35%) and 26 (53%) patients with respectively HER3 negative and positive tumor (p = 0.007). No differences were observed for stable disease. Median PFS was 6.3 months in patients showing HER3 negative tumors and 2.8 months for those who had HER3 overexpressing tumors (p < 0.0001). Median overall survival was 13.6 months in patients showing HER3 negative tumors and 10.5 months for those who had HER3-expressing tumors (p = 0.01).CONCLUSIONSHER3 proved to be a predictive factor for clinical outcome in KRAS wild-type colorectal cancer patients treated with cetuximab. Combined HER3 and KRAS analysis may represent an effective strategy for a better selection of responding colorectal tumors. Furthermore besides identifying colorectal cancer patients refractory to EGFR directed treatment, HER3 overexpression may also represent a potential biological indicator for the development of a new class of antineoplastic agents in this setting. 6145 Background: The transition from curative to palliative care is a difficult phase in the illness trajectory of many oncologic patients (pts). Change of the health care professionals involved in EoL assistance may result in a sense of abandonment for pts and families. Methods: A semistructured telephone interview was conducted by two psychologists on relatives of pts who died between 01/2008 and 06/2009 (time from death ranged between 6 and 24 months). Research questions focused on the last month of life and included oncologist's involvement, sense of abandonment if the patient-oncologist relationship was lost, satisfaction with the quality of care (measured with a five-point scale: poor, fair, good, very good, excellent; and converted to a 0-to-100 scale) and oncologist's involvement in bereavement activities. A final open-ended question addressed suggestions for improvement. Results: Fifty-eight patient's relatives were contacted, 50 accepted the interview (32 spouses, 14 children, 3 in-laws, 1 nephew). Twenty-two pts had died at home, 28 in hospital. In 39 (78%) cases the oncologist-patient relationship was maintained in the last month of life, and this continuity was highly appreciated by the family. For the 11 pts (26%) who lost contact with their oncologist, a sense of abandonment was reported only in one case; in all other cases there was a closure of the patient-physician relationship that prevented feelings of abandonment. While the mean score of overall satisfaction relative to the quality of care in the last month of life was 61, this score dropped to 34 for pts who were no longer followed by their oncologist. Only in 13 (26 %) cases there was a post-mortem communication between the family and the oncologist, always on the family's initiative. Every relative interviewed expected at least a phone call from the oncologist. Conclusions: Continuity of care at the EoL is a priority issue for the families of cancer pts. The daily routine of palliative care and hospice facilities should involve the oncologist to improve the experience of care. 4126 Background: Previous reports have suggested that mucinous colorectal adenocarcinomas have a poorer prognosis than nonmucinous colorectal adenocarcinomas. This retrospective analysis was conducted to explore whether mucinous carcinoma (MC) is associated with a worse prognosis than nonmucinous carcinoma (NMC) for patients with Dukes B2 and C radically resected colon cancer. Methods: We investigated 1,006 unselected patients who underwent curative surgery for sporadic colon cancer and followed up at six Oncology Department between 1998 and 2006. Univariate and multivariate analyses were performed to determine prognostic factors of survival. Results: MC accounted for 17.9% (n=180) of all colon carcinomas. Patient characteristics were as follows. MC: M/F 104/76; median age, 68 (range, 28–97); pT1/2/3/4, 1/4/153/22; Dukes B2/C 98/82; invasion 26 (14%); ≥12 examined lymph nodes, 115 (64%); adjuvant chemotherapy, 110 (61%). NMC: M/F 445/381; median age, 68 (range, 29–95); pT1/2/3/4, 9/51/715/51; Dukes B2/C 384/442; invasion 199 (24%); ≥12 examined lymph nodes, 499 (60%); adjuvant chemotherapy, 545 (66%). MC were more frequently located in the proximal colon (54.4% versus 34.6% for NMC; p<0.001). No difference between MC and NMC in disease-free survival (hazard ratio, HR 1.01; 95% CI, 0.76–1.36; p=0.92) and overall survival (HR 1.05; 95% CI, 0.74–1.49; p=0.78) was found. After stratification by stage of disease, MC and NMC had no statistically significant difference in 5-year disease-free survival (Dukes B2: 79.1% and 78.1%, respectively, p=0.86; Dukes C: 53.8% and 56.2%, respectively, p=0.58) and overall survival (Dukes B2: 84.2% and 85.5%, respectively, p=0.80; Dukes C: 68.0% and 67.3% p=0.52). Multivariate analysis using the Cox proportional hazards model showed that the clinically significant prognostic factors were stage at diagnosis (p<0.0001), grading (p<0.0001), and number of lymph node examined (p=0.0002) in the specimen. Conclusions: In this preliminary analysis, patients with mucinous histology who underwent surgery with curative intent for stage Dukes B2 and C colon cancer had similar prognosis compared to NMC. e20632 Background: Elderly cancer patients (pts) population is expanding due to demographic changes. Currently 2.4 % of Italian population is older than 85, with this group accounting ∼8 % of all cancer pts in our geographic area. Since very elderly (85 years and over) cancer pts are generally excluded from clinical trials, few data are available about tolerability of chemotherapy in this population. Methods: We conducted a retrospective analysis of cancer pts aged 85 years and over receiving chemotherapy for advanced disease in the years 2005–2007 in three Oncology Unit of the Regione Marche, Italy. Results: We identified 50 patients (26 males, 24 females) with a mean age of 86.4 (range 85–95), ECOG PS 0 (4 pts) 1 (25 pts) 2 (13 pts) 3 (8 pts). Type of cancer (pts): NSCLC (13), colorectal (11), breast (5), prostate (4), gastric (3), NHL (3), bladder (2), head-neck (2), ovarian (2), vulvar (1), skin (1), pancreas (1), GIST (1), UPT (1). Main co-morbidities included hypertension (18 pts), COPD (8 pts) and heart disease (6 pts). The median number of cycles in first line chemotherapy were 6 (1–44); 20 pts received 2 or more lines of chemotherapy (range 2–5). Dose reductions were planned in all pts: in 26 dose reduction was 30 %, in 22 was 50%, in 2 > 50 %. Most used drugs were: vinorelbine os or iv (14 pts), capecitabine (9 pts), gemcitabine (7 pts). Target agents were used in 7 pts (5 erlotinib, 2 gefitinib, 2 rituximab, 1 sunitinib). Ten partial responses were observed; main toxicities were: grade 3–4 neutropenia (10 %), grade 3 diarrhea (5 %), and 1 pts had grade 3 hand-foot syndrome. No treatment related deaths were observed. Conclusions: Very elderly cancer pts (85 years and over) in good PS and few co-morbid conditions receiving dose reduced chemotherapy experienced acceptable toxic effects; a partial response was documented in 10 out of 50 pts. The expanding use of chemotherapy and target therapy in this clinical setting has profound influence on health care management and costs. Prospective studies specifically designed for this pts population could clarify the benefit, in terms of quality of life and survival, of an interventionist instead of a supportive care only approach. The interleukin-1 receptor antagonist (IL-1RA) cytokine is thought to counteract tumor angiogenesis/metastasis. Two single nucleotide polymorphisms in the IL-1RA gene (rs4251961 T/C and rs579543 C/T ) influence IL-1RA circulating levels with highest production in carriers of the homozygous rs4251961 T/T and rs579543 T/T genotypes. A total of 180 patients with metastatic colorectal cancer were categorized as high IL-1RA producers if they were carriers of at least one of the rs4251961 T/T or rs579543 T/T genotypes ( T/T carriers). Median survival times were 35.8 months (95% confidence interval: 29.7–43.7 months) and 28.6 months (95% confidence interval: 25.6–30 months) in 56 T/T carriers and in 124 non- T/T carriers, respectively. The favorable association between T/T carriers’ status and survival was significant in the multivariate analysis ( P =0.018). Also, T/T carriers and non- T/T carriers were prevalent among patients with Karnofsky performance status 90–100 and 70–80, respectively ( P =0.002). These findings encourage additional studies in this field and the evaluation of a recombinant-IL-1RA for anticancer activity.
We investigated the association between thymidylate synthase (TS) germline polymorphisms and response to 5-fluorouracil-based chemotherapy in 80 patients with liver-only metastatic colorectal cancer (MCRC). The tandem repeat polymorphism (VNTR) in TS 5′-untranslated region (5′-UTR), which consists of two (2R) or three (3R) 28-bp repeated sequences, with or without a G/C nucleotide change in 3R carriers (3G or 3C) and a 6-bp insertion/deletion (6+/6−) in the TS 3′-UTR, was studied. The distinction between high (2R/3G, 3C/3G and 3G/3G) and low (2R/2R, 2R/3C and 3C/3C) TS expression genotypes according to the 5′-UTR VNTR+G/C nucleotide change showed significant association with tumour response (P=0.01). In particular, high TS expression genotypes were found in 8 out of 34 patients (23.5%) with complete or partial response and in 24 out of 46 patients (52%) with stable disease and disease progression. Liver-only MCRC patients are a homogeneous and clinical relevant subgroup that may represent an ideal setting for studying the actual influence of TS polymorphisms.
BACKGROUND The prognostic significance of KIT or platelet-derived growth factor receptor alpha (PDGFRalpha) mutations in gastrointestinal stromal tumors (GISTs) is still controversial. PATIENTS AND METHODS In all, 104 patients were diagnosed with GISTs by KIT immunoreactivity; tumor DNA was sequenced for the presence of mutations in KIT exons 9, 11, 13 and 17 and in PDGFRalpha exons 12 and 18. Disease-free survival (DFS) was analyzed in 85 radically resected patients. RESULTS KIT mutations occurred in exon 11 (69), in exon 9 (11) and in exon 17 (1). PDGFRalpha mutations were detected in exon 18 (10) and in exon 12 (3). Ten GISTs were wild type. Exon 11 mutations were as follows: deletions in 42 cases and point mutations in 20 cases and insertions and duplications, respectively, in 2 and 5 cases. A better trend in DFS was evident for duplicated and point-mutated exon 11 KIT GISTs. There was a significant association between PDGFRalpha mutations, gastric location and lower mitotic index. Moreover, PDGFRalpha-mutated GISTs seemed to have a better outcome. CONCLUSIONS Point mutations and duplications in KIT exon 11 are associated with a better clinical trend in DFS. PDGFRalpha-mutated GISTs are preferentially localized in the stomach and seem to have a favorable clinical behavior.
The objective of this study was to investigate the efficacy of first-line chemotherapy containing irinotecan and/or oxaliplatin in patients with advanced mucinous colorectal cancer. Prognostic factors associated with response rate and survival were identified using univariate and multivariate logistic and/or Cox proportional hazards analyses. The population included 255 patients, of whom 49 (19%) had mucinous and 206 (81%) had non-mucinous colorectal cancer. The overall response rates for mucinous and non-mucinous tumours were 18.4 (95% CI, 7.5–29.2%) and 49% (95% CI, 42.2–55.8%), respectively (P=0.0002). After a median follow-up of 45 months, median overall survival for the mucinous patients was 14.0 months compared with 23.4 months for the non-mucinous group (hazard ratio (HR), 1.74; CI 95%, 1.27–3.31; P=0.0034). After adjustment for significant features by multivariate Cox regression analysis, mucinous histology was associated with poor overall survival (HR, 1.593, 95% CI, 1.05–2.40; P=0.0267), together with performance status ECOG 2, number of metastatic sites ⩾2, and peritoneal metastases. This retrospective analysis shows that patients with mucinous colorectal cancer have poor responsiveness to oxaliplatin/irinotecan-based first-line combination chemotherapy and an unfavourable prognosis compared with non-mucinous colorectal cancer patients.
PURPOSE:The objective is to investigate whether polymorphisms with putative influence on fluorouracil/oxaliplatin activity are associated with clinical outcomes of patients with advanced colorectal cancer treated with first-line oxaliplatin, folinic acid, and fluorouracil palliative chemotherapy.MATERIALS AND METHODS:Consecutive patients were prospectively enrolled onto medical oncology units in Central Italy. Patients were required to have cytologically/histologically confirmed metastatic disease with at least one measurable lesion. Peripheral blood samples were used for genotyping 12 polymorphisms in thymidylate synthase, methylenetetrahydrofolate reductase, xeroderma pigmentosum group D (XPD), excision repair cross complementing group 1 (ERCC1), x-ray cross complementing group 1, x-ray cross complementing protein 3, glutathione S-transferases (GSTs) genes. The primary end point of the study was to investigate the association between genotypes and progression-free survival (PFS).RESULTS:In 166 patients, ERCC1-118 T/T, XPD-751 A/C, and XPD-751 C/C genotypes were independently associated with adverse PFS. The presence of two risk genotypes (ERCC1-118 T/T combined with either XPD-751 A/C or XPD-751 C/C) occurred in 50 patients (31%). This profiling showed an independent role for unfavorable PFS with a hazard ratio of 2.84% and 95% CI of 1.47 to 5.45 (P = .002). Neurotoxicity was significantly associated with GSTP1-105 A/G. Carriers of the GSTP1-105 G/G genotype were more prone to suffer from grade 3 neurotoxicity than carriers of GSTP1-105 A/G and GSTP1-105 A/A genotypes.CONCLUSION:A pharmacogenetic approach may be an innovative strategy for optimizing palliative chemotherapy in patients with advanced colorectal cancer. These findings deserve confirmation in additional prospective studies.
